Sony Pictures Classics waltzes off with 'Bashir' at Cannes — Expect a hefty Oscars push

May 26, 2008 |  9:45 pm

Following up on the kudos success it experienced with "Persepolis" at the last derby, Sony Pictures Classics just snatched up a similar flick at Cannes: "Waltz with Bashir. " Our Entertainment News and Buzz blog describes it as "an animated autobiographical documentary about a former Israeli Army soldier who tries to recount his long-forgotten mission in the first Lebanon War in the early eighties." READ MORE. Expect a major Oscar push, natch.

"Persepolis" won kudos as best animated featured from the New York and L.A. film critics, plus it picked up some Cesar Awards. It was nominated for best animated feature at the Oscars.
